- Thomas Tuchel left Jude Bellingham out of his latest England squad for the Wales friendly and the World Cup qualifier against Latvia.
- Gordon said Bellingham should be an automatic pick when fit and playing regularly for Real Madrid, noting the midfielder’s recent injury layoff.
- The Newcastle winger said he is operating with a "paranoid" edge to secure a World Cup berth as competition for places intensifies.
- Gordon highlighted his display in last month’s 5-0 win in Belgrade as a step forward but said he has shown only "50 per cent" of his potential for England.
- He described Harry Kane as a "genius" whose playmaking suits his game, adding that he frequently seeks the captain’s advice to improve.
